What you'll find is a list of open source (cc) Tkinter + Python vtutorials, done on a GNOME desktop, by a gent named Chieh in Boston (although he used to live in Madrid). He's got an entry at the PythonInfo Wiki: http://wiki.python.org/moin/Intro_to_programming_with_Python_and_Tkinter If you check the OurMedia archive, you'll see he's allowing Remix in non-commercial work, i.e. a student could splice Chieh clips into some later work (with attribution): http://ourmedia.org/node/2128 "I must apologize that many people would find my lectures over simplified or goes too slow. I wrote these lectures aimed for kids and people that never had any programming experience.
